- Story Text: Hungarian Prime Minister Viktor Orban on Tuesday (October 4) held talks with Saudi business delegations in an attempt to increase economic relations between the two countries.
The President of the Council of the Saudi Chamber, Abdullah Saeed al-Mobty welcomed Orban and his delegates in Riyadh for bilateral talks.
"By presiding over the European Union at the session of June 2011, you may work on urging the European side to sign a free trade agreement with the Gulf Cooperation Council," al-Mobty told Orban at the start of their meeting. Orban replied that Hungary was interested in adding Saudi Arabia to their coalition partners.
"Speaking for Hungary, we have obtained two-thirds majority in recent elections and thus Hungary became the most stable country in Central Europe and in all of Europe," Orban told the Saudi delegation. He then asked al-Mobty to agree on a joint economic committee. - Copyright Holder: REUTERS
